Pasta Fagioli Soup (Italian Bean & Pasta Soup)

Here’s a hearty, comforting Pasta Fagioli Soup—classic Italian-style, packed with beans, pasta, and rich tomato flavor 🍲🇮🇹

🛒 Ingredients

  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 lb ground beef (or Italian sausage)
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p Italian seasoning
  • ½ tsp red chili flakes (optional)
  • 1 can (15 oz) crushed tomatoes
  • 1 can (15 oz) tomato sauce
  • 4 cups beef or chicken broth
  • 1 can (15 oz) kidney beans, drained & rinsed
  • 1 can (15 oz) cannellini beans, drained & rinsed
  • 1 cup small pasta (ditalini, elbow, or shells)
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ley or basil, chopped
  • Grated Parmesan cheese for serving

👩‍🍳 Directions

Step 1: Sauté the Base

  •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
  • Add onion, carrots, and celery; cook 5–7 minutes until soft.
  • Add garlic and cook 30 seconds.

Step 2: Brown the Meat

  • Add ground beef.
  • Cook until browned, breaking it up.
  • Drain excess fat if needed.

Step 3: Build the Soup

  • Stir in salt, pepper, Italian seasoning, and chili flakes.
  • Add crushed tomatoes, tomato sauce, and broth.
  • Bring to a gentle boil.

Step 4: Simmer

  • Reduce heat and simmer 20 minutes.

Step 5: Add Beans & Pasta

  • Stir in kidney beans, cannellini beans, and pasta.
  • Simmer 10–12 minutes, until pasta is tender.

Step 6: Finish

  • Taste and adjust seasoning.
  • Stir in fresh parsley or basil.

🍽️ Serving Suggestions

  • Top with grated Parmesan
  • Serve with crusty bread or garlic bread
  • Drizzle with olive oil before serving

🔥 Pro Tips

  • Cook pasta separately if storing leftovers (prevents soggy pasta)
  • For thicker soup, mash some beans before adding
  • Use Italian sausage for deeper flavor
  • Add spinach or kale for extra nutrition

🧊 Storage

  • Refrigerate up to 4 days
  • Freeze without pasta for best results (up to 2 months)

🍝 Variations

  • Vegetarian: Skip meat, use vegetable broth
  • Creamy: Add ¼ cup cream
  • Spicy: Extra chili flakes
  • Slow Cooker: 6–8 hours on low (add pasta last)
